Runaway Deck by Collectors’ Workshop
(c. 1985) (Submit Review) (Submit Update)Effect: A wonderful gag deck from Collectors’ Workshop:
- Performer does card masterpiece.
- Masterpiece fails.
- Deck tries to commit suicide before audience does.
If you’ve longed for an animated deck with a mind of its own (and who hasn’t), this is it! “Now for my greatest miracle,” declares Conjurer. At that moment, deck begins to sneak silently across table, “Stop.” commands the Wonder Worker. Deck obediently stops on command — considers what is to come — then continues to run away. Limitless possibilities with this, the close-up worker’s most candid critic.
Pack moves sans thread — sans all outside attachments. “Must be a bicycle deck,” theorizes fast thinking Wizard, deck moves again. Performer picks up pack and reads small print. “That explains it: Rider Backs.”
Make your card magic a truly moving experience.
